  • Thai Airways is charting a course for growth, reaffirming its stance that adding more aircraft to its fleet will be essential. Meanwhile, Qantas is continuing to prepare for the upcoming delivery of the Airbus A321XLR, with the expected date approaching. Lastly, Ryanair, one of Boeing's most important customers, has been incredibly vocal about its displeasure with the manufacturer's current state of recent years.
